    Labor and Employee Relations Specialist

    Penn State is seeking a skilled Labor and Employee Relations Senior Specialist. This position plays a key role in advancing positive labor and employee relations across all University locations. Reporting to the Senior Director of Labor and Employee Relations, the successful candidate will serve as a subject matter expert in union relations and will be actively involved in matters related to faculty and graduate assistant unionization at Penn State. This role serves as a primary point of contact for Human Resource Strategic Partners, managers, and employees on employee relations and labor relations matters and provides consultative guidance in support of the University’s labor strategy.

    The duties will include:

    • With a focus on faculty and graduate assistants, serving as a subject matter expert on union relations, including day-to-day administration of labor agreements and proactive engagement with union representatives on a variety of issues, with an emphasis on higher education academic environments.
    • Advising on the resolution of employment and disciplinary issues.
    • Counseling employees and advising leaders on sensitive workplace concerns, risk mitigation, and appropriate resolution pathways.
    • Interpreting, applying, and assisting in the development of policy and contract language, and advising various audiences on appropriate application; assisting in drafting contract language and related labor documents as needed.
    • Coordinating and/or assisting with investigations that arise from grievances, University hotlines, direct complaints, as well as those escalated from colleges and work units; synthesizing findings and recommending outcomes consistent with policy, law, and applicable agreements.
    • Representing the University at informal problem-solving meetings and at formal grievance hearings, serving as liaison among management, employees, and union representatives; participating at the bargaining table and supporting bargaining strategy, proposals, and documentation.
    • Assisting with implementation and administration of newly negotiated agreements, including developing guidance, templates, and tools to support consistent application across colleges and units.
    • Training management and HR colleagues on new contracts, interpretation, and administration expectations; serving as a resource for ongoing questions and complex cases.
